Tussle between three workers at Gangolli, one stab other two with knife

Tue, 04 Oct 2016 13:16:57    S.O. News Service

Gangolli: In an incident which took place near Church road in Gangolli, the fight between three laborers went so far that one among them injured his other two co-workers by attacking them with a knife.

According to the received information, the three laborers Rajesh, Bhaskar and Viany who were working at a construction site on Church road got involved in a scrimmage for unknown reason. Consequently, Vinay plunged a knife into Bhasker’s belly. In between this he even attacked the other person, which resulted in the knife getting plunged into Rajesh’s thigh. The hands of Rajesh were also injured in attempt to save himself from the attack.

It is said that soon after attacking his co-workers, Vinay stealthily tried to flee away from the place after collecting his bag from the room. But as soon as the news was received, police had already reached the incident spot and collected the information. Vinay who was trying to flee, was stopped by police near Tawheed School and was taken to police station on the basis of suspicion. The investigation at the police station confirmed the crime made by him and he was taken into the police custody.

The injured have been admitted to the Kundapur Hospital.

It is said that Vinay hailed from Assam, whereas, Rajesh and Bhasker were the natives of Mangaluru. Sources said that Rajesh and Bhasker had come to work in Gangolli just before three days. The reason for the fight between the three is not yet known.

The case has been registered in Gangolli police station and PSI Subanna is investigating the case.
